Step 4: ORM migration cutover. The legacy Quillbase ORM layer in the Marstow billing service has been replaced with the new repository pattern under src/persistence. Reviewers should confirm that all raw query strings were removed from the handlers and that transaction scopes now flow through the UnitOfWork adapter. Before deploying to the Ostermere staging cluster, the service account used by the new connection pool must be configured. Add the following line to the service's .env file:

secret setting of hawep-yahig: LEDGER_TOKEN29=41b5d6315371c92885eaeb077fb63

Subject: Quickstore 4.2 — bloom filter now fronts the KV layer

Plugin authors: starting with this release, Quickstore places a bloom filter ahead of the key-value store. Negative lookups return faster; false positives fall through safely. No API changes are required on your side. Verify your plugin against the staging build referenced below.

session token of fahif-tadup = htk3_9c7

# SproutMinder client setup
#
# This block wires up the watering scheduler against the
# internal Drizzle API. Don't be clever here — the scheduler
# is picky about timezones, and the Fernwood greenhouse team
# will notice fast if pumps fire at 3am. Retries are capped
# at five; beyond that we just skip the cycle and log it.
# The client authenticates with the key directly below.

app token of kahif-tawif = qvz15-i12BqYS9lsDqEa1

Quick update before Thursday's session. The reseller programme for Korrida Analytics has outpaced expectations — 34 partners signed since launch, with the Halwick region leading. Margins are holding at the agreed floor, though two partners are pushing for deeper discounts on the Pulsegrid bundle. Marek from channel ops will walk through the tiering proposal; department heads should flag resourcing concerns in advance. One thing we'd rather not circulate widely yet is attached directly below this paragraph.

confidential, kagup-bafog: Fraaxax Group is in early talks to buy Soroxox Group for about $343.8 million. The Olidor launch date is June 14, and nothing goes to the press before then. Legal wants the Aldmirek Logistics term sheet signed before July 23.